A car has a mass of 820 kg. It starts from rest and travels 41 m in 3.0 s. What is the force applied to the car?

Assuming constant acceleration, 
s = 1/2 at^2, so 

1/2 * a * 3^2 = 41 
a = 9.111 

And, we all know that F = ma
